Woman killed in southeastern N.B. crash

One person has died after a two-vehicle crash in southeastern New Brunswick, according to police.

First responders were called to the scene on Route 11 in Cocagne shortly before 11 p.m. Saturday.

Investigators believe a vehicle travelling southbound crossed the centre line and hit a northbound vehicle.

The driver of the northbound vehicle, a 51-year-old woman from Saint-Antoine, died at the scene.

Police said the driver of the other vehicle suffered what were believed to be serious injuries.

A section of Route 11 was closed for several hours but has since reopened.

Investigators are looking to speak with anyone who may have witnessed the crash who has dash camera footage.
